Pirate's Cove Resort,is a waterfront hideaway on Florida's Treasure Coast offering a unique getaway for rest and relaxation, or great excitement and fun.The pet friendly 50 room hotel is situated at the edge of its own private marina in the historic fishing village of Port Salerno. We are a full service marina, equipped with 50 slips for boats up to 80 feet in length. Our resort offers guests the option to arrive by water via the inter coastal waterway or by car just off Dixie Hwy.On premises is our Pirate's Loft restaurant. Lounge and waterfront TIKI BAR offers fresh seafood,crisp salads and a large array of mouth watering appetizers await you. Live music on Friday and Saturday. We spent two nights for my fiancé's birthday. We had no expectations and were absolutely delighted with our entire experience. We arrived and at first could not find the lobby for check in - then we realized check in was in the adorable gift shop! Arkeda checked us in and was absolutely charming and gave us lots of ideas of where to spend our time. She actually took the time to call the marina to make sure our boat was ready for the next day. She made us fresh coffee daily and was just a pure pleasure. The gift shop had alot of neat gifts, fresh sandwiches, cold drinks. The entire staff was amazingly nice and dog friendly. The grounds are really beautiful with all of the flowers and foliage. Our room was very clean with king bed and sofa with coffee table, and desk. The balcony overlooked the marina. There was live music both Friday and Saturday and we were allowed to take our dog to the Tiki Bar downstairs. We had a couple of issues after our stay, but Annie was superb at assisting us, a true professional. We plan to make this an annual trip, and we will stay at Pirate's Cove. Highly recommend.

We stay at this Resort once to twice every year and have never had as horrible an experience as this trip. We were never told up front that there is no maid service. After three days we had to argue to finally have someone come and clean which did not occur until our 4th day. We had roaches in our room and a huge build up of towels (being in the pool and out on a boat creates a lot of towels) and garbage. If you needed toilet paper or any other items for the room you had to go to front desk and ask. Not acceptable service.

The waterfront rooms are not too bad. We had pool noise but no restaurant/bar noise
Unfortunately, breakfasts are only offered at the restaurant on weekends, but the hotel lobby/gift shop does offer a small selection of packaged, single-serving cereals for purchase. The Whistle Stop cafe is about 1 mike away.
Yes but the air conditioner is very loud
No ramp at the marina but there are two Ramps less than a Mile away. The marina does have a forklift for launching if you keep your boat there
